antique insurance, also known as collectibles insurance, is a specialized type of insurance designed to protect valuable antiques from damage, theft, or loss. While traditional homeowners insurance may cover some personal property, it often falls short when it comes to high-value items like antiques. antique insurance provides the coverage needed to safeguard these precious possessions and give owners peace of mind.
One of the main benefits of antique insurance is that it provides coverage for the full value of the item, unlike traditional homeowners insurance which may only cover a fraction of the item’s worth. Antiques are unique and often irreplaceable, making it essential to have the proper insurance in place to protect them. With antique insurance, owners can rest assured that their beloved possessions are fully protected in the event of any unforeseen circumstances.
Another advantage of antique insurance is that it can be tailored to meet the specific needs of each individual. Coverage options can include protection against damage from fire, theft, vandalism, natural disasters, and more. Additional coverage may also be available for restoration costs, loss of value, and even shipping and transit. By working with an insurance provider that specializes in antiques, owners can customize their policy to ensure comprehensive protection for their valuable possessions.
When it comes to insuring antiques, it’s crucial to have the items appraised by a professional to determine their true value. This valuation will help ensure that the items are adequately insured and that the policy accurately reflects their worth. It is recommended to have antiques appraised regularly as their value may increase over time, especially for items that are rare or in high demand.
In addition to valuation, owners should keep detailed records of their antiques, including photographs, receipts, and any documentation of authenticity. These records can be invaluable in the event of a claim and can help expedite the insurance process. It’s also a good idea to take steps to protect antiques from damage by storing them properly, using security measures like alarms or safes, and taking precautions when displaying or transporting them.
